This short play follows the story of Sally putting on make up. She hasn’t been out in months, not after what the press said, but she’s fallen in love with the bin man.
A comic, poignant short new play written by Cardiff writer Rick Allden, performed by Andrea Hall and directed by Lisa Diveney.
